We decided to start the New Year off with a hike, and chose Mt. Herman Trail near Monument, Colorado. The trail was described in the guide we read as ”a short but fairly steep hike with impressive views at the top.” The round-trip distance to the Monument is 2.2 miles. With plenty of sunshine left in the rather short days at this time of year and practically no wind, we decided to continue to the mountain behind the monument for a total round trip distance of just over four miles.
